Tetri is an AI-powered web-based application that allows users to play the classic Tetris game directly on a web page. It combines interactive gameplay with AI-driven features to enhance the experience. Tetri is designed to be user-friendly, offering an intuitive interface for both casual and competitive players.
• Browser-Based Play: Play Tetris directly on a web page without any downloads.
• Classic Gameplay: Experience the timeless mechanics of Tetris with falling blocks and line-clearing objectives.
• Scoring System: Earn points by clearing lines and completing levels.
• Leaderboards: Compete with other players to achieve the highest score.
• Customizable Controls: Adjust keyboard controls to suit your playstyle.
• Daily Challenges: Participate in daily puzzles or speed runs for rewards.
• Cross-Platform Support: Play on any device with a modern web browser.
